Ingredients for Almond Butter Banana Protein Smoothie

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:

  • Ripe Bananas: Opt for bananas that are spotty; they are sweeter and perfect for blending into smoothies.
  • Almond Butter: Choose natural almond butter without added sugars for the healthiest option that keeps it creamy.
  • Protein Powder: Use your favorite protein powder, whether it’s whey or plant-based—this boosts the nutritional profile.
  • Milk (or Milk Alternative): Any milk works here! Almond milk adds extra nuttiness while soy or oat milk makes it creamier.
  • Honey or Maple Syrup: Optional sweeteners if you want extra sweetness; adjust to your taste preference.

How can I make my Almond Butter Banana Protein Smoothie thicker?

To achieve a thicker Almond Butter Banana Protein Smoothie, consider using frozen bananas instead of fresh ones. Frozen bananas provide a creamy texture without diluting the flavor. Additionally, you can add Greek yogurt or oats for extra thickness. If you prefer a nutty flavor, increasing the amount of almond butter will also help thicken your smoothie while enhancing its taste and nutritional benefits.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 ripe bananas
  • 2 tablespoons almond butter
  • 1 scoop (30g) protein powder
  • 1 cup milk (or milk alternative)
  • 1 tablespoon honey or maple syrup (optional)

Instructions

  1. Gather all ingredients on the counter.
  2. Add ripe bananas and almond butter to the blender.
  3. Scoop in the protein powder.
  4. Pour in the milk and add ice if desired.
  5. Blend until smooth and creamy.
  6. Taste and adjust sweetness with honey or maple syrup if needed.
  7. Serve immediately.

Nutrition

  • Serving Size: 1 smoothie (approximately 400g)
  • Calories: 450
  • Sugar: 28g
  • Sodium: 180mg
  • Fat: 18g
  • Saturated Fat: 2g
  • Unsaturated Fat: 16g
  • Trans Fat: 0g
  • Carbohydrates: 56g
  • Fiber: 6g
  • Protein: 20g
  • Cholesterol: 5mg
